Stock for stock, the R32 is a faster car than the MINI in a drag race, considering it has AWD and more power. Even with the header upgrade, I doubt you'd win against an R32. Oh, just so you know, my roomie has an 2004 R32 and I have a fairly modded up 2k3 MCS, so I'm well aware of the potential of both cars. Let's just say, I need more power. Perhaps after a header and head upgrade, I'll hope to catch up to him. Then again, he will always have better traction, so it might not matter anyways. Good luck, though! The R32 only has about 240 hp and it weighs over 3500lbs. Tested 0-60 times are in the mid 6's. The MCS should beat it hands down.
